Overview

The boutique 2-star Park City Hostel is situated about a 10-minute drive from Park Silly Sunday Market and features a sun deck, a picnic area, and various recreational opportunities. Offering a car park on site, the hostel is just a minute's drive from Olympic Park.

Location

The nearby sports attractions include Park City Ice Arena and Sports Complex, 3.5 km away. Align Spa is merely 600 metres away, and Park City Mountain, available to diversify your stay, is about a 25-minute walk away.

Salt Lake City International airport is 60 km from this hostel, and Bonanza Drive & Lower Iron Horse Loop Road bus stop is nearly a 5-minute walk away.

Rooms

There are 49 rooms with views of the mountain equipped with ironing facilities and climate control. Apart from entertainment options like complimentary wireless internet and a cable flat-screen television, guests may also make use of a sofa. Some rooms feature lockers, as well as bunk beds. To enhance guest convenience, a hair dryer and bath sheets are provided in the bathrooms.

Eat & Drink

Serving Mediterranean dishes, Nosh is just near the property. Guests will also find a shared kitchen in the hostel.
